Rebecca Green is professor of the practice of law and co-director of the Election Law Program at William & Mary Law School. In a 2014 case called National Labor Relations Board v. Noel Canning, the Supreme Court blessed a method of interpretation known as “liquidation” that seeks to identify settled practice as a means of understanding ambiguous constitutional text.
